Passport to Home

As part of our Passport approach, we offer a post-discharge transitional care program called Passport to Home.

Passport to Home goals:

  • Close the gap between care at facilities and care at home
  • Ensure patients are fully supported throughout their transition to, and once home
  • Improve access to providers in the community to support recovery goals
  • Reduce preventable hospitalizations

Our patient-centered home health care includes:

  • Nurse Practitioner Visit Within 24-48 Hours
  • Telehealth Visits
  • Remote Patient Monitoring
  • Chronic Care Management
  • Educational Materials
  • At-Home Therapy Extenders
